A long arm walking foot sewing machine is distinguished by its extended sewing space, typically measuring between 18 to 30 inches, which provides ample room for handling larger projects like quilts or upholstery. This extended length allows sewists to maneuver bulkier fabrics with ease, ensuring smooth, consistent stitching throughout the project. Unlike traditional sewing machines, these long arm machines use a 'walking foot' mechanism, which feeds multiple layers of fabric evenly through the needle. This is particularly advantageous when sewing thick materials, as it helps to prevent puckering and ensures precise alignment.
